# List Database Objects With Disk Usage
I'll often times use `\d` or `\dt` to check out the tables in my database.
This shows the schema, object name, object type (e.g. `table`), and owner
for each.
By adding the `+` to that meta-command, I can also see the disk usage for
each database object.
Here is an example of look at all tables in a database with the additional
`Size` (or disk usage) information:
```sql
> \dt+
List of relations
Schema | Name | Type | Owner | Size | Description
--------+--------------------+-------+------------+------------+-------------
public | amount_types | table | jbranchaud | 16 kB |
public | ingredient_amounts | table | jbranchaud | 8192 bytes |
public | ingredient_types | table | jbranchaud | 16 kB |
public | ingredients | table | jbranchaud | 48 kB |
public | recipes | table | jbranchaud | 16 kB |
public | schema_migrations | table | jbranchaud | 16 kB |
public | users | table | jbranchaud | 16 kB |
```
